首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 171 毫秒
1.
传统烟花算法求解大规模离散问题存在收敛速度慢、求解精度不高等问题.针对旅行商问题的特点,提出一种带固定半径近邻搜索3-opt的离散烟花算法.该算法基于基本烟花算法进行离散化改进,采用整数编码的路径表示方法来表示旅行商问题的解,对爆炸算子、高斯变异算子进行离散化操作策略设计.为了使算法具有较好的局部搜索能力,提出固定半径近邻搜索3-opt策略来提高算法精度和收敛速度,同时采用不检测标志策略提高算法效率.实验结果表明:该算法能有效地求解旅行商问题,其离散烟花算子在全局收敛能力、收敛精度、求解时间和稳定性等方面均优于传统烟花算子;基准测试算例的最优解平均误差率仅为0.002%,优于对比算法.  相似文献   

2.
针对帝国竞争算法在求解旅行商问题时局部搜索能力不强和容易陷入局部最优的缺陷,提出一种基于自适应继承策略的帝国竞争算法.该算法采用自适应继承策略的启发式交叉算子、单点局部插入策略和固定邻域的2-opt算子来增强算法的局部优化能力,并加入帝国精英解集以保持种群的多样性.通过标准实例测试,验证了所提出的改进策略的优越性,与基于启发式交叉算子和帝国主义算法为框架的其他算法进行对比,实验结果表明,该算法求解中小规模的解旅行商问题具有较高的求解精度和较快的收敛速度.  相似文献   

3.
针对遗传算法求解旅行商问题(TSP)时容易早熟、收敛速度慢等问题,提出一种基于探索—开发—跳跃策略的单亲遗传算法(EDJS-PGA)。该算法将基因移位、倒序、交换三种算子组合构成探索策略,用于扩展解的搜索空间,增强算法全局搜索能力;再将logistic混沌映射和改良圈操作融合为一种混沌映射改良圈算子,用于增强算法的局部搜索能力,构成开发策略;最后针对种群中的同优个体设计了近邻变异算子,构成跳跃策略,增强了算法跳出局部最优解的能力,使其兼具个体变异、局部优化、防止早熟等多重作用。通过对18个TSP实例进行仿真实验,结果表明EDJS-PGA相较于传统单亲遗传算法具有更高的求解精度和收敛速度,且最优解偏差率和平均误差率均处于较低水平;与其他文献对比,EDJS-PGA具有更强的鲁棒性和求解效率。  相似文献   

4.
基于分段混合蛙跳算法的旅行商问题求解   总被引:1,自引:0,他引:1  
针对旅行商问题(TSP)在搜索后期解的多样性和精度下降的问题,提出一种解决TSP问题的分段混合蛙跳算法(S-SFLA)。该算法在搜索初期利用逆转变异算子减少交叉路径,在搜索的后期引入邻域搜索(个体邻域,局部最优领域,全局最优邻域)增加种群多样性。在整个搜索过程中记忆全局历史最优解与局部历史最优解,进行全局更新和局部更新,避免迂回搜索。在局部更新中,每一个青蛙都有机会得到更新。实验结果表明,与遗传算法、蚁群算法、基本蛙跳算法相比,S-SFLA算法在求解中等规模的TSP问题上具有更快的搜索速度和更高的求解精度。  相似文献   

5.
一种求解旅行商问题的进化多目标优化方法   总被引:1,自引:0,他引:1  
陈彧  韩超 《控制与决策》2019,34(4):775-780
为了克服传统小生境(Niching)策略中的参数设置难题,提出一种求解旅行商问题的进化多目标优化方法:建立以路径长度和平均离群距离为目标的双目标优化模型,利用改进非支配排序遗传算法(NSGAII)进行求解.为了在全局探索能力与局部开发能力之间保持平衡,算法中采用一种使路径长度相同的可行解互不占优的评价策略,并通过一种新的离散差分进化算子和简化的2-Opt策略生成候选解.与已有算法的数值试验结果比较表明,求解旅行商问题(TSP)的改进非支配排序遗传算法(NSGAII-TSP)能够更好地保持种群多样性,从而克服局部最优解的吸引并具有更鲁棒的全局探索能力.通过借助特殊的个体评价策略,所提出的算法可以更好地进行全局优化,甚至同时得到多个全局最优解.  相似文献   

6.
针对差分进化(DE)算法存在的早熟收敛与搜索停滞问题,提出了自适应合并与分裂的多种群差分进化算法。算法将种群划分为多个子种群,引入子种群优劣因子来评价种群的优劣性,实现种群间的自适应合并与分裂;对于种群中的各个个体,采取基于精英池学习的变异算子,结合优秀个体进行自适应学习调整,使算法达到全局搜索与局部搜索能力的平衡;在算法后期引入扰乱策略,保证算法快速收敛的同时有效地跳出局部极值点,提高算法寻优的精度。在30个标准测试函数的实验结果表明,改进算法能有效解决早熟和陷入局部最优的问题。  相似文献   

7.
针对加工时间为模糊数的柔性作业车间调度问题,考虑最小化模糊最大完工时间、模糊机器总负荷、模糊关键机器负荷为优化目标,提出一种有效求解该类优化问题的多目标进化算法。算法采用一种混合不同机器分配和工序排序策略的方法产生初始种群,并采用插入空隙法对染色体进行解码。定义一种新的基于可能度的个体支配关系和一种基于决策空间的拥挤算子,并将所提支配关系和拥挤算子运用于快速非支配排序。接着,提出一种基于移动模糊关键工序的局部搜索策略对种群中的优势个体进行局部搜索。通过试验研究关键参数对算法性能的影响并将所提算法与3种不同的优化算法作对比。结果表明,所提算法能够比其它算法更有效解决多目标模糊柔性作业车间调度优化问题。  相似文献   

8.
针对单一种群算法较难权衡全局寻优能力和局部搜索能力的问题,提出一种种间双系统协作蝙蝠优化算法。根据蝙蝠个体运动状态将整个种群分为探测系统和开发系统,并通过信息交流进行进化协作。设计和运用动态变化算子实现全局寻优和局部寻优的实时平衡,利用位置更新算子减少开发系统随机性带来的影响,提高局部区域的开发效率,运用伪变异算子保持探测系统的多样性,提高全局搜索的效率。实验结果表明,该算法在快速收敛的同时能够避免陷入局部最优,可解决多局部极值的复杂优化问题。  相似文献   

9.
针对差分进化算法在优化过程中容易陷入局部最优和收敛精度不高的问题,提出一种多种群协同进化的差分进化算法。首先提出双序法用于种群划分:同时使用距离系数排序和适应度值排序将种群划分为三个子种群,将离全局最优个体远且适应度值优秀的个体划分出来,可以有效的避免陷入局部最优。其次对每个子种群采用不同的变异策略和控制参数,同时对整体表现一般的种群采用概率判定机制选择变异策略,以平衡全局探测和局部搜索。最后将所提算法在CEC2017测试集上进行实验仿真,实验结果表明,所提算法在收敛精度、跳出局部最优等方面均优于其他改进DE算法。  相似文献   

10.
赵文超  郭鹏    王海波    雷坤 《智能系统学报》2022,17(2):376-386
针对以最小化最大完工时间的柔性作业车间调度问题,在标准樽海鞘群算法(salp swarm slgorithm, SSA)的基础上,提出一种改进的樽海鞘群算法。采用基于工序和基于设备的二维向量进行编码,并考虑设备负载进行种群初始化。基于Lévy飞行对领导者位置更新方式进行离散化改进;在追随者位置更新公式中引入自适应惯性权重,使算法的全局搜索和局部搜索能力得到更好的平衡。为提高搜索效率,设计了交叉算子和基于关键路径的变异算子来保证种群的多样性,同时引入模拟退火(simulated annealing,SA)策略,改善算法的局部搜索能力。通过采用标准算例进行对比计算,结果验证了所提算法的有效性。  相似文献   

11.
提出一种混合改进遗传算法的嵌套分区算法用于求解旅行商问题。该算法首先使用加权抽样法产生初始最可能域,用全局数组保存每个区域的历史最优解,设计子域交叉算子和子域变异算子,并用改进的遗传算法搜索每个子域和裙域的最好解,然后对Lin-Kernighan算法进行改进,并且在搜索裙域中最好解时,对种群中优秀个体用改进的Lin-Kernighan算法进行优化。对TSPLIB中问题实例的仿真结果表明,所提出的混合改进遗传算法的嵌套分区算法在求解旅行商问题时可以获得高质量的解。  相似文献   

12.
十进制MIMIC算法是基于MIMIC二进制编码算法思想的可用来求解TSP的离散分布估计算法。着重考虑该算法在较大规模TSP问题上的算法缺陷,对其编码方式和概率模型进行了改进,提出了新的个体生成策略,在初始化种群阶段使用了贪心算法,在进化过程中引入了杂交算子、变异算子、映射算子、优化算子等演化算子,采用了动态调整方法来确定优势群体的规模。以上改进使得算法在小种群解大规模TSP问题的情况下仍可保持种群的多样性。实验结果表明,改进算法在求解规模、求解质量和寻优速度上都有明显提高。  相似文献   

13.
In this paper, we proposed a genetic algorithm for the one-commodity pickup-and-delivery traveling salesman problem. In the proposed algorithm, we designed a new tour constructing heuristic to generate the initial population, and proposed a novel pheromone-based crossover operator that utilizes both local and global information to construct offspring. In addition, a local search procedure was embedded into the genetic algorithm to accelerate convergence. The proposed genetic algorithm was tested on benchmark instances with up to 500 customers, and the computational results show that it gives a faster and better convergence than existing heuristics.  相似文献   

14.
针对工作量平衡的多旅行商问题,提出了一种融合杂草算法繁殖机制和局部优化变异算子的改进遗传算法(Reproductive mechanism and Local optimization mutation operator based Genetic Algorithm,RLGA)。该算法利用入侵杂草优化算法中以适应度为基准的繁殖机制来产生种群并进行遗传操作,以此来提高算法的搜索效率;同时提出一种混合局部优化算子作为变异算子来提高算法的局部搜索能力,从而提高收敛精度。实验结果表明,RLGA在求解工作量平衡的多旅行商问题时可以快速收敛到较优解,并且求解精度得到了很大的提高。  相似文献   

15.
嵌套分区算法是近年来提出的一种求解大规模优化问题的新型全局优化方法。介绍了嵌套分区算法(NPM)的基本思想,将其应用于求解旅行商问题。分析确定了嵌套分区算法各个算子的策略,提出了一种改进的嵌套分区算法。该算法采用加权抽样法求得初始最可能域,用全局数组记录下每个区域的历史最优解,用3-opt局部搜索算法改进每个区域解的质量。对TSPLIB中部分实例仿真结果表明,所提出的结合3-opt算法的改进嵌套分区算法在求解 TSP问题时可以获得高质量的解。  相似文献   

16.
改进的遗传算法求解旅行商问题   总被引:2,自引:0,他引:2  
提出一种解决旅行商问题的改进遗传算法.在传统遗传算法的基础上,引入贪婪算法进行种群初始化;从遗传进化代数和个体适应函数值两个方面实现遗传参数自适应调节,在加快寻优速度的同时防止寻优陷入局部最优;采用基于贪婪方法的启发式交叉算子优化交叉结果;对交叉前后的种群分别实施精英个体保留策略,保证最优基因结构得以延续.实验结果分析表明,改进的遗传算法可以在种群规模较小的情况下具有更可靠的寻优能力.  相似文献   

17.
许秋艳  马良  刘勇 《控制与决策》2022,37(8):1962-1970
针对基本阴阳平衡优化算法计算精度低和优化速度慢等问题,提出一种新型阴阳平衡优化算法.首先,设计小波精英解学习策略,充分利用精英解的进化信息产生高质量的解,用于算法的全局勘探和局部开发;然后,将搜索角度引入解更新方程中,以实现对算法搜索空间的全方位搜索,并对所提出算法的收敛性进行理论分析;最后,采用连续优化测试函数和瓶颈旅行商问题进行数值实验,并将所提出算法与多种智能优化方法进行比较.实验结果表明,所提出算法具有更好的优化性能.  相似文献   

18.
In this paper, a hybrid genetic algorithm (GA) is proposed for the traveling salesman problem (TSP) with pickup and delivery (TSPPD). In our algorithm, a novel pheromone-based crossover operator is advanced that utilizes both local and global information to construct offspring. In addition, a local search procedure is integrated into the GA to accelerate convergence. The proposed GA has been tested on benchmark instances, and the computational results show that it gives better convergence than existing heuristics.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号